#f3b2f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3b2f1 is composed of 95.3% red, 69.8%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301.8 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 82.5%. #f3b2f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e765e3.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#f3b2f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080108 is the darkest color, while #fef6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3b2f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d4d1d4 is the less saturated color, while #fda8fb is the most saturated one.
